LINUX.ORG.RU
решено ФорумAdmin

Проброс траффика из win12

 , ,


0

1

Добрый день.
Извините за win.
Не могу понять.
Есть vpn, подключаюсь к нему.
Есть удаленная машина, доступная по rdp (только при включенном vpn).
Есть rest api (запросы get/post для простоты) доступный через этот rdp по некоему адресу.
В этом rdp доступен интернет.
Вне rdp этот rest api не доступен.

Как сделать чтобы с локальной машины тоже можно было слать запросы, как через rdp?


По RDP боюсь что никак.

Просто пробросить http порт через эту удалённую машину нельзя?

Hater ★★ ()

Запустить на «удаленная машина, доступная по rdp» socks прокси и попробовать подконнектиться туда с локальной машины. Если получилось, заворачивай все запросы в этот сокс, если нет, то разреши доступ к порту на который повесил сокс в правилах windows firewall на том сервере, если не можешь - проси админа. А так за подробной инструкцией на винфак, да. Экспериментировать с освобождением порта 3389 под твой сокс вместо rdp не советую, особенно если ты не один на тот сервер ходишь ;)

NightOperator ★★★ ()
Последнее исправление: NightOperator (всего исправлений: 2)
Ответ на: комментарий от Hater

Под vpn, через файл Подключение к удаленному рабочему столу (.rdp), (смотрю там сигнатуры и адрес есть какие-то)
По поводу сокс - не могу понять как правильно сделать заворачивание (на rdp есть putty), если допустим сокс прокси сделаю (сейчас поищу, я так понял это чтобы был публичный ip)

NoName ()
Последнее исправление: NoName (всего исправлений: 3)
Ответ на: комментарий от NoName

(смотрю там сигнатуры и адрес есть какие-то)

Вот именно, там IP адресс удалённого хоста. Просто пробрось HTTP на какой-нибудь свободный порт.

Hater ★★ ()
Ответ на: комментарий от NoName

через файл Подключение к удаленному рабочему столу (.rdp)

У тебя на локальной машине тоже винда что ли?

Если вдруг да тогда ответ на вопрос «не могу понять как правильно сделать заворачивание» - proxifier на локальной машине, а вот дальше всё-таки на винфак ;)

NightOperator ★★★ ()
Ответ на: комментарий от Hater

Там не ip, а доменное имя(blabla.bla.ru) с указанием номера терминала (правда машина на vmware и тогда получается что их может быть много).
Здесь не понятно это одна машина или нет.

Допустим одна. Пингуется.
Putty есть. А как настроить проброс. Извините за тупой вопрос. Понимаю что это очень просто, но не разу не делал.

NoName ()
Последнее исправление: NoName (всего исправлений: 2)
Ответ на: комментарий от NoName

А как настроить проброс.

На винфак же. Это не имеет никакого отношения к линуксу.

Hater ★★ ()
Ответ на: комментарий от NoName

емним у putty была такая хрень как plink.exe, но вообще-то да, на винфак.

anc ★★★★★ ()
Ответ на: комментарий от anc

Да причем здесь plink. Порт 22 закрыт и даже телнетом не открывается, поэтому и у putty черная консоль.
Админских прав нет, непонятно теперь как быть (

Я сделал дамп открытых портов, но я так понимаю это не поможет.

NoName ()
Последнее исправление: NoName (всего исправлений: 1)
Ответ на: комментарий от NoName

Порт 22 закрыт

Какой ещё 22 порт на винде? Перестань употреблять тяжёлые вещества.

Hater ★★ ()
Ответ на: комментарий от someoneelsenotme

Вроде же обещали, что вин10 последняя, потом не будет больше релизов (ну или что-то в таком духе).

Hater ★★ ()
Ответ на: комментарий от Hater

Proto Local Address Foreign Address State PID
TCP 0.0.0.0:135 0.0.0.0:0 LISTENING 708
TCP 0.0.0.0:445 0.0.0.0:0 LISTENING 4
TCP 0.0.0.0:2701 0.0.0.0:0 LISTENING 3896
TCP 0.0.0.0:3389 0.0.0.0:0 LISTENING 2156
TCP 0.0.0.0:5985 0.0.0.0:0 LISTENING 4
TCP 0.0.0.0:8081 0.0.0.0:0 LISTENING 1388
TCP 0.0.0.0:47001 0.0.0.0:0 LISTENING 4
TCP 0.0.0.0:49152 0.0.0.0:0 LISTENING 520
TCP 0.0.0.0:49153 0.0.0.0:0 LISTENING 1000
TCP 0.0.0.0:49154 0.0.0.0:0 LISTENING 612
TCP 0.0.0.0:49155 0.0.0.0:0 LISTENING 364
TCP 0.0.0.0:49156 0.0.0.0:0 LISTENING 612
TCP 0.0.0.0:49157 0.0.0.0:0 LISTENING 1224
TCP 0.0.0.0:49158 0.0.0.0:0 LISTENING 604
TCP 0.0.0.0:49159 0.0.0.0:0 LISTENING 2156
TCP 127.0.0.1:49383 0.0.0.0:0 LISTENING 9376
TCP 127.0.0.1:49780 0.0.0.0:0 LISTENING 9164
TCP 127.0.0.1:50646 0.0.0.0:0 LISTENING 2288
TCP 127.0.0.1:51882 0.0.0.0:0 LISTENING 4532
TCP 127.0.0.1:52025 0.0.0.0:0 LISTENING 5144
TCP 127.0.0.1:53013 0.0.0.0:0 LISTENING 9344
TCP 127.0.0.1:53338 0.0.0.0:0 LISTENING 12680
TCP 127.0.0.1:53341 0.0.0.0:0 LISTENING 12612
TCP 127.0.0.1:53570 0.0.0.0:0 LISTENING 9512
TCP 127.0.0.1:55794 0.0.0.0:0 LISTENING 8004
TCP 127.0.0.1:56283 0.0.0.0:0 LISTENING 13044

NoName ()
Ответ на: комментарий от NoName

Это ни о чём не говорит. Совсем не интересно что уже занято, совсем интересно что доступно из того, что не зафаерволлено.

Hater ★★ ()
Ответ на: комментарий от NoName

До вашего ответа на мой вопрос вы ни в одном месте не упомянули что это не Win12.

someoneelsenotme ()
Ответ на: комментарий от NoName

Да причем здесь plink. Порт 22 закрыт

А при чем здесь 22 порт?

anc ★★★★★ ()
Ответ на: комментарий от anc

22 это ssh

На данный момент получилось подключиться из интерусующей машины по telnet на локальную. А нужно в обратную сторону, но так не получается пока

NoName ()
Последнее исправление: NoName (всего исправлений: 1)
Ответ на: комментарий от anc

Поставил openssh. Подключаюсь с удаленного сервера на локальный по ssh успешно.
Делаю второй вариант по ссылке http://putty.org.ru/articles/putty-ssh-tunnels.html
Но чето не работает. Такое ощущение что фигня осталась.
Подскажите пж-та.

NoName ()
Ответ на: комментарий от anc

получилось получить доступ к ssh c обоих сторон, как теперь сделать так, чтобы можно было вызывать rest запросы как будто с удаленной машины?

NoName ()
Вы не можете добавлять комментарии в эту тему. Тема перемещена в архив.